The pack bridge (first trial) (1926)

Robert Sargent Austin

engraving

Prints and Drawings Department, British Museum, London

Details

Classification:

Print

Physical Object Description:

View of bridge at Aylestone, Leicestershire, with man driving two horses across, open landscape beyond. 1926 Engraving. Signed with initials on plate. Signed with initials, dated and annotated: "1st trial 2 proofs".

Technique:

Engraving

Dimensions:

12.3 x 11.3 cm

Accession Number:

1927,0709.140

Credit:

Presented by the Contemporary Art Society, 1927

Ownership history:

Purchased by Campbell Dodgson (1867-1948) for the Contemporary Art Society, with the Prints and Drawings Fund, 1926; presented to the Prints and Drawings Department, British Museum, London, 1927
